From Remploy candidate to branch co-ordinator

12th October 2007

Ian Cane Remploy Plymouth's new branch co-ordinator
Ian Cane is revelling in his new job as Remploy Plymouth’s branch coordinator. The branch is part of an expanding network of branches for the UK’s leading provider of employment services for people with disabilities and health conditions.

Originally attending the Plymouth branch on Armada Way as a jobseeker, Ian was so impressed with the friendly atmosphere and great team that he applied for a job vacancy at the branch and was thrilled to be successful in gaining employment.

In his new role Ian is responsible for greeting disabled candidates looking for work and assessing their eligibility for the various Remploy vocational development programmes offered at branch. These allow candidates to develop a broad skill base and include interview techniques, CV workshops, job searching support and confidence building.

Ian, who has hearing loss, tinnitus and repetitive strain injury in his wrists understands the barriers people with health conditions can encounter. He explains: “I used to do physical work but my health conditions made this increasingly difficult. I was out of work for two years before retraining with Remploy and now I am really confident using the skills I learnt here as a candidate to help others find work in the local community.”

Branch manager Barbara Field says: “Ian is a real star. He understands the candidates and fits into the team really well. It’s been brilliant see Ian using his skills to inspire jobseekers to achieve their full potential.”
